Rats are an increasingly ubiquitous presence in urban environments worldwide, with their populations continuing to rise in the face of an escalating climate crisis and deteriorating environmental conditions. Recent studies and observations from municipalities and wildlife experts have revealed a concerning trend, warning that rat infestations are not only persistent, but also spreading to new areas.
While urban rats pose a significant threat to public health, particularly through the transmission of serious diseases, they also cause considerable economic damage to properties, businesses, and local infrastructure. Moreover, the presence of rodents is often indicative of deeper infrastructure issues and waste management problems.
According to leading entomologists, the increased population of rats is largely driven by two key factors: climate change and urbanization. The changing weather patterns and shifting ecosystems resulting from climate change have created an environment that is conducive to the proliferation of rodent populations. Furthermore, the ongoing pace of urbanization has led to the destruction of natural habitats, resulting in an influx of displaced rodents into densely populated areas.
“It is no secret that our environment is under immense pressure,” noted Dr. Jane Wilson, an expert in conservation biology at the University of Cambridge. “The consequences of climate change are far-reaching and multifaceted. Unfortunately, urban rats are simply one symptom of this deeper crisis.”
Urban rat infestations have significant economic implications, with a study by the UK’s Local Authority Association suggesting that local authorities incur substantial expenses in the eradication of rodent infestations and subsequent cleanup efforts. While some cities have implemented initiatives aimed at controlling the spread of rat populations, often through a combination of biological and chemical control methods, more sustainable long-term solutions are required.
To mitigate the impact of urban rats on public health and local economies, experts recommend adopting a multi-faceted approach, encompassing enhanced waste management and infrastructure maintenance, combined with a comprehensive rodent control strategy that prioritizes humane population control methods.
Ultimately, addressing the growing rodent population necessitates a fundamental rethink of urban planning strategies, waste management practices, and public health policies. The need for a coordinated and long-term response to this escalating public health concern has become increasingly clear.
